What Is It?
Lactobacillus fermentum is a species of lactic acid bacteria commonly used in probiotic formulations. It is naturally found in some fermented foods and the human gastrointestinal tract. As a probiotic, it is taken as a dietary supplement with the aim of potentially supporting intestinal health through influencing the balance and function of gut microbiota.
How It May Work in the Body
As a probiotic, Lactobacillus fermentum may influence gut health by modulating the composition and activity of the intestinal microbiome. It is thought to interact with the gut lining and immune system, potentially enhancing intestinal barrier integrity and immune responses within the gastrointestinal tract. However, the specific biological mechanisms remain under investigation:
- The precise pathways and interactions in humans have not been definitively established.
- Most mechanistic insights come from laboratory (in vitro) or animal studies rather than robust human trials.
- Direct evidence for its functional roles in the human body is currently insufficient.
Therefore, while the theoretical framework for benefits exists, human studies are needed to confirm how Lactobacillus fermentum works in vivo.

Natural Sources
Lactobacillus fermentum is found in various fermented foods that broadly contain lactic acid bacteria, such as:
- Fermented dairy products like yogurt and kefir
- Fermented vegetables such as sauerkraut and kimchi
- Other fermented foods where Lactobacillus species are part of the natural microbiota
Nonetheless, the specific presence and amounts of Lactobacillus fermentum within these foods can vary widely.
Absorption and Bioavailability
As a live bacterial probiotic, Lactobacillus fermentum does not undergo absorption in the conventional sense like nutrients or drugs. Instead, its potential benefits depend on:
- Survival through the acidic environment of the stomach
- Ability to adhere and colonize the intestinal mucosa
- Interaction with other microbiota and the host’s immune system
However, the factors governing colonization efficiency and longevity in the gut remain inadequately characterized, and no conclusive data clearly define the bioavailability or comparative effectiveness of different supplement forms.

Quality, Standardization and What to Look For
When selecting Lactobacillus fermentum supplements, consider the following:
- Products that specify strain identification and viability (colony-forming units – CFUs)
- Manufacturers who follow good manufacturing practices (GMP) and have third-party testing for purity and potency
- Proper storage instructions to maintain the viability of live cultures
- Transparency in labeling including dose per serving and recommended usage
Because evidence on dosage and efficacy is limited, quality assurance becomes even more crucial.
